A.Dear Client,
First Step,Write to the S.P. of the district concerned.If possible meet him /her.
While sending the Application try to send it by SPEED POST, keep the Receipt and Consignment number and take a Print out of the delivery report which you might use later.
File a Complaint Case as soon as you can.

A.It is the discretion of the police to decide about filling of charge sheet.But the police cannot keep investigation pending to help the accused. U can approach high court in a writ petition for speedy investigation. Surely high court will pass appropriate orders to ensure that justice is done.if high court does not grant appropriate orders as u desire, u can approach supreme court also.
